This Morning regular Matthew Wright issued a health update (Image: ITV/YOUTUBE) Matthew Wright has been inundated with messages of support after being taken to the hospital, explaining that his latest health update is a "bit grim, frankly". The This Morning regular told his social media followers he was rushed to A&E again at the weekend after being left in excruciating pain. Taking to X on Sunday (July 14), the 59 year old tweeted: "Unbelievable.

I’m back in hospital after the nerve kicked off big time, screaming grinding pain. Paramedics once again incredible but no resolution on the horizon which is a bit grim frankly x." Just hours earlier, the LBC presenter said he had been recovering well, as he stated: "I’m doing ok - pregabalin is good, pain now just annoying, I don’t want to tear my head off any more! Getting an MRI tomorrow and guided steroid injection some time after.

Hopefully that’ll do the job thanks again for the love never experienced pain like it!"
